Default Is there a Hemi in that thing?

yes, but not this kind, representative of a 66 or 67 Street Hemi

426 Cubic inches / 7.1L
4.25" bore
3.75" stroke
~ 475 net HP
~ 390 ft / lbs TQ
Twin Carter AFBs
Mechanical lifters
big / heavy overhead valve train
2.25" intake valves!!!

massively heavy, NOT fun lifting heads off over the fenders of a B body.
hard to tune

but very impressive visually.

A good 440-6 was typically a better choice
